Coming back this November with a refreshed format, bigger cast and tougher challenges, Home Run: Singapore transforms the everyday work of real estate agents into a high-stakes, reality-TV-style obstacle course. Let’s break down the madness.


Unpredictable Challenges That Would Make Anyone Sweat

Across five episodes, 14 real estate agents are thrown into a whirlwind of surprise client briefs, unexpected curveballs, and real-world property scenarios — all designed to test their instincts, creativity, and nerves of steel. The Hosts Bringing the Fun (and Chaos)

Guiding us through the madness are social personalities SneakySushii and Dewy Choo, who add the perfect blend of humour and relatability. Their commentary feels like watching the show with your funniest friends - the ones who point out the drama before you even catch it.

Returning champ Claire Tan joins as a resident judge, bringing sharp insight and that “I’ve been in your shoes” perspective. Each episode also features rotating industry experts, so contestants are constantly evaluated through fresh lenses.


What’s at Stake? More Than Just Bragging Rights

The winning agent walks away with $11,000 in PropertyGuru Credits which is a huge boost for visibility and business growth. Developer partners like SingHaiyi Group are also stepping in with additional prizes for standout performers who show grit, heart and exceptional spirit throughout the competition. This isn’t just entertainment, it’s a celebration of the passion behind Singapore’s property dreams.

Catch Home Run: Singapore starting 12 November 2025, airing every Wednesday at 9.30 PM on Channel 5, mewatch, and PropertyGuru’s YouTube channel. This marks PropertyGuru’s first official media partnership with Mediacorp, so expect lots of buzz across TV, radio, digital and social.
